2.3.4.1 Cognitive Taxonomy of Data

Cognitive Layers

Return to Top

There are five different layers in the Cognitive Model. (See Appendix I: Cognitive Model). Each piece of “data” used within a DIDO can be classified accordingly. For example, the number of cents in a dollar might be classified as Data. Note: to help differentiate the generic, general, all encompasing use of “data” from the specific cognitive “Data”, the cognitive layer is referred to with an Tite case (i.e., first letter is capitalized).

Stavros and Albrant 1) define the five layers of the Cognitive Model as follows:

Figure 1: Cognitive Model
  1. Data - Data that is a raw concept; it simply exists and has no significance beyond its existence (in and of itself). It is the basis upon which Information concepts are built
  2. Information - A concept aggregating data concepts together, in other words, Data that has been given meaning by way of relational connection
  3. Knowledge - A concept relating appropriate collection of Information concepts together, such that it's intent is useful
  4. Understanding - An interpolative and probabilistic concept that reflects Wisdom concepts
  5. Wisdom - An extrapolative and nondeterministic, non-probabilistic concept which is built upon Understanding concepts.

The flow between the cognitive layers is bidirectional and can have many-to-many relationships. For example, any particular Wisdom concept can be associated with any number of Understanding concepts. The inverse is also true; Understanding concepts can also be used to help support any number of Wisdom Concepts.

Data Protection

Return to Top

When it comes to Data Protection, it is important to differentiate between the raw content in the system and the other is the system in which the raw data is stored. The raw data is generally considered as facts while the system it is stored in is referres to as the Database.

Facts are not by themselves potected under U.S. Copyright law. For example, you can not copyright the temperature recorded outdoors.

The U.S. does provide some protection of data (i.e., facts) as they are organized into a datastore (i.e., databases) 2):

In the United States, facts by themselves are not protected by copyright. Therefore, data, as a collection of facts, is not protected by U.S. copyright law.
Databases as a whole can be protected by copyright as a compilation, but only under certain conditions. The first is that mere collection of data is not enough. The arrangement and selection of data must be sufficiently creative or original.3)

The European Union (EU) under the Directive 96/9/EC provides no protrction of data 4)
